diff --git a/src/main/webapp/WEB-INF/manager/cms/generate/index.ftl b/src/main/webapp/WEB-INF/manager/cms/generate/index.ftl
index 78ca3b5c..775cc5e4 100644
--- a/src/main/webapp/WEB-INF/manager/cms/generate/index.ftl
+++ b/src/main/webapp/WEB-INF/manager/cms/generate/index.ftl
@@ -47,8 +47,10 @@
- {{homeLoading?'更新中':'生成主页'}}
- 预览主页
+ <@shiro.hasPermission name="cms:generate:index">
+ {{homeLoading?'更新中':'生成主页'}}
+ @shiro.hasPermission>
+ 预览主页
@@ -92,9 +94,12 @@
-
- {{articleLoading?'更新中':'生成文章'}}
-
+ <@shiro.hasPermission name="cms:generate:article">
+
+ {{articleLoading?'更新中':'生成文章'}}
+
+ @shiro.hasPermission>
+
@@ -116,9 +121,12 @@
+ <@shiro.hasPermission name="cms:generate:column">
{{columnLoading?'更新中':'生成栏目'}}
+ @shiro.hasPermission>
+